Cranberry Coconut-water Faux-jito
Take a handful of cranberries and muddle them with a tablespoon of mint leaves and 1-2 tablespoons of sugar, depending on how sweet you like your drink (you can also throw the whole thing in the food processor if you prefer). To this mixture, add the juice of one lime, then fill up the rest of your glass with a combo of coconut water and sparkling water. Rim your glass with sugar and garnish with mint for an extra-fancy touch.

Hot Buttered Un-rum
Mix 1 tablespoon each of softened butter and brown sugar in a few tablespoons of boiling water. Add 1 teaspoon of rum extract*. Pour into a glass garnished with a cinnamon stick and lemon peel studded with cloves. Fill the rest of the glass with boiling water. Top with whipped cream! *Extract contains a very small amount of alcohol; you can cook the alcohol off on the stove or in the microwave if you wish. You may also be able to find oil- or glycerin-based rum flavoring at a specialty bake supply store.

Virgin Sangria
Sangria is a great way to get some fruit and fiber along with your beverage. Choose the juice of your choice as a base. Pomegranate or concord grape juices are great for red sangria; for a white version, white grape or apple will work. Fill with whatever fruit you like: apples, pears, berries, citrus letting the mix chill in the fridge for a while will allow the flavors to mingle. You can also add a splash of brandy extract to give it a more authentic taste.

Molasses Mule
The Moscow mule is a classic cocktail made with vodka and ginger ale. This mocktail version subs in molasses for a rich-tasting drink thats also high in iron. Dilute 1 tablespoon of molasses (not blackstrap) in hot water. Add the juice of one lime. Allow to cool. Fill the glass with ginger ale and garnish with mint. Virgin Mary
This version of a Bloody Mary adds an unusual but very pregnancy-appropriate ingredient: pickle juice! Mix 1-2 ounce of pickle juice with 6 ounce of tomato or vegetable juice. Add a teaspoon of horseradish (less if it's super spicy and you don't like spicy), ½ teaspoon of celery salt, and the juice of one lemon. If you're into hot, add some Tabasco and black pepper. Pour over ice and garnish with celery or a pickle!

Kir Speciale
Sometimes just bubbles are enough to make you feel festive, but bright, pretty things bubbling around in your glass takes it to another level. Defrost a few frozen berries and drop them in your sparkling cider glass. The juice will add color and the buoyant berries will do wonders for your social morale.

Creamsicle Eggnog
You can buy regular eggnog mix at the supermarket, but here's a twist: Blend ¾ cup vanilla frozen custard or premium ice cream with 1 cup orange juice and 1 tsp rum extract (optional). Top with cinnamon, nutmeg and orange zest, and, if you're feeling like pulling out all the stops, whipped cream.

Mulled Pomegranate Juice
Pomegranate juice can be a striking stand-in for red wine, even all by itself. But add some heat and spices and it will be a dead ringer for the real mulled thing.
